Advanced Imaging and Technological Capabilities
When it comes to visualizing the internal structures of the body, Michigan diagnostic centers utilize state-of-the-art technology. Magnetic Resonance Imaging (MRI) and Computed Tomography (CT) scans are routinely employed to generate detailed cross-sectional images, aiding in the detection of tumors, neurological disorders, and musculoskeletal injuries. Furthermore, facilities across the state often offer functional imaging such as fMRI and PET scans, providing insights into metabolic activity and blood flow that static images cannot reveal.
Specialized Neurological and Cardiac Diagnostics
For patients concerned with neurological health, Michigan diagnostic services include comprehensive evaluations for conditions ranging from epilepsy to neurodegenerative diseases. Electroencephalograms (EEGs) and evoked potential tests measure electrical activity in the brain, while specialized neurologists interpret these results to formulate management strategies. Similarly, cardiology departments offer advanced stress tests, echocardiograms, and Holter monitoring to detect irregularities in heart function, often catching issues before they escalate into serious events.
The Role of Laboratory Medicine
Beyond imaging, the michigan diagnostic landscape relies heavily on sophisticated laboratory medicine. Clinical laboratories process thousands of samples daily, conducting blood work, urinalysis, and genetic testing. These labs play a vital role in infectious disease detection, hormone level analysis, and cancer marker screening. The speed and accuracy of these tests are crucial, as they often dictate the urgency and direction of subsequent medical interventions.
Navigating the Healthcare System
Understanding how to access diagnostic services in Michigan can significantly reduce stress for patients. Referrals from primary care physicians remain a common pathway, though many imaging centers allow self-referral for certain services. Insurance coverage is a key consideration, and patients are advised to verify benefits with their providers to avoid unexpected costs. Telemedicine platforms also serve as a valuable tool, allowing individuals to discuss symptoms and determine the necessity of an in-person diagnostic appointment.
